Start with portfolio tracking. A solid tracker pulls balances from multiple addresses and chains, normalizes token prices, and shows realized vs unrealized P&L. Short sentence. Most tools do the basics. Fewer tools reconcile LP positions with underlying token exposures correctly, and that’s a big gap for active DeFi users who care about real risk exposure rather than shiny APY numbers.
On one hand you want live data. On another, you don’t want noisy price swings to trigger bad decisions. Initially I thought real-time meant nonstop alerts, but then realized curated signals with context are better—alerts that say why something matters, not just that it happened. Actually, wait—let me rephrase that: alerts should prioritize based on your stake, slippage risk, and recent protocol changes.
DeFi protocols are the heart of yield and trading opportunities. Yield farming, staking, lending, automated market makers, and on-chain derivatives each carry a unique risk profile. Wow! Protocol design matters—a lot. Some have upgradable contracts, others are time-locked, and a few are centrally controlled in practice despite being marketed as “decentralized”. I’m biased, but I prefer audits plus a community that’s active and loud.
When evaluating a protocol, I look at TVL trends, token concentration, and incentive structures. Medium sentence here. Smart contract risk is high when a single controller can pause withdrawals. Long sentence—if you’re putting a meaningful portion of your portfolio into a new protocol, assume the worst-case exploit scenario and size positions so that you can sleep at night even if the headline comes on Twitter at 3 a.m.
Advanced trading features in a browser extension can flip passive holders into active, smarter traders. Limit orders that execute on-chain, sliced order execution to reduce slippage, and integrated DEX aggregators that route across liquidity sources matter. Hmm… My first trades in DeFi taught me that slippage eats returns silently, and order routing combined with gas timing can preserve alpha.
But trade execution is more than speed. It’s about context-aware decisions—like knowing when your limit order should include a gas boost to beat an MEV sandwich, or when to break a large trade into smaller tranches to avoid moving the market. Short burst. Seriously? Yes, you’d be surprised how many folks still paste large amounts into a single swap and then complain about price impact.

Portfolio tracking features I insist on:
- Multi-chain balance aggregation and historical P&L.
- LP and staking position decomposition (so you can see underlying risk).
- Custom alerts for price, APY shifts, and governance votes.
- Trade simulation and estimated slippage before execution.
Some of those are rare. Many tools report token balances but not how your LP shares correlate to token prices. That omission makes your risk look smaller than it is. Something bugs me about dashboards that show only APR and not the real, after-fee, after-gas yield—very very important in practice.

On monitoring DeFi protocol health, watch these signals: sudden TVL outflows, shrinking liquidity depth, concentration of LP tokens in few wallets, and opaque token emissions. Short burst. Also keep an eye on governance votes; sometimes governance decisions radically alter contract behavior and your exposure overnight.
Interoperability and cross-chain moves require a strategy beyond trusting bridges blindly. Use reputable bridges, prefer audited relayers, and split amounts across paths when moving large sums. Hmm… my gut says limit bridge use for speculative hops unless you really need that exposure, because reorgs and relay failures still happen.
Privacy and security tradeoffs exist. Browser extensions may store local state for convenience; understand what is stored and encrypted. Also consider hardware-backed signing for big trades. How do I reconcile LP positions in a portfolio tracker?
Good question. Short answer: you need decomposition—convert LP tokens to underlying assets using the pool’s reserves at the time of valuation and track your share. Medium sentence. Long sentence—for historical accuracy also account for fees earned and token inflows/outflows so your realized gain from providing liquidity reflects more than just token price moves.
Can a browser extension reliably execute advanced trades like on-chain stop-losses?
Yes, but implementation matters. Some extensions integrate with smart contract-based automation or relayers that can trigger trades when conditions meet. Short burst. Watch for permission creep and prefer extensions that require explicit signatures for each action rather than blanket approvals.
Is it safe to connect multiple DeFi platforms to one extension?
Mostly—but practice defense in depth. Use separate accounts for high-risk positions, keep main funds in cold storage, and only connect the account you’re willing to trade from. Long sentence—if you’re dabbling with experimental protocols, create throwaway accounts and keep the bigger allocations isolated.
